Global Polyvinyl Alcohol (PVA) Market Overview

The global pol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) market is valued at USD 1.465 billion, based on a five-year historical analysis. This growth is primarily driven by the increasing demand for biodegradable packaging materials and the expanding textile industry. PVA's unique properties, such as excellent film-forming capabilities and water solubility, make it a preferred choice in various applications, including food packaging and textile manufacturing.

Asia Pacific dominates the PVA market, with countries like China and Japan leading due to their robust industrial base and significant investments in research and development. The region's dominance is attributed to the high demand for PVA in textile sizing, paper coatings, and adhesive formulations, supported by the presence of major manufacturers and a well-established supply chain.

In 2023, 32 countries updated their safety and handling standards for polymeric materials, reflecting growing concerns about chemical exposure risks in manufacturing. This included mandates on labeling, storage, and handling procedures, particularly for high-risk chemicals. Regulatory changes ensure safer handling across supply chains, aligning with global safety standards and affecting PVA distribution practices, especially in industrial applications.

Global Polyvinyl Alcohol (PVA) Market Segmentation

By Grade: The market is segmented by grade into fully hydrolyzed, partially hydrolyzed, sub-partially hydrolyzed, low foaming grades, and other grades (including tactified and fine particle grades). Fully hydrolyzed PVA holds a dominant market share due to its superior film-forming properties and high tensile strength, making it ideal for applications in textiles and paper manufacturing.

By Application: PVA finds applications in food packaging, paper manufacturing, construction, electronics, textile manufacturing, and other sectors. Food packaging leads the market share, driven by the increasing demand for biodegradable and water-soluble packaging solutions that align with environmental sustainability goals.

By Region: Regionally, the market is divided into North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, Latin America, and the Middle East & Africa. Asia Pacific holds the largest market share, primarily due to the high consumption of PVA in textile and packaging industries, supported by rapid industrialization and urbanization in countries like China and India.

Global Polyvinyl Alcohol (PVA) Industry Analysis

Growth Drivers

Rising Demand for Biodegradable Packaging: With increasing environmental concerns, there is a marked shift toward biodegradable packaging materials. According to the World Bank, global waste generation is expected to reach 2.2 billion tons in 2024, increasing the need for eco-friendly packaging solutions. PVAs water solubility makes it ideal for such applications, contributing to a substantial rise in demand, particularly in regions like North America and Europe, which collectively generate over 30% of global waste. In 2023, several countries reported a 12% rise in government-led biodegradable packaging initiatives, underlining the role of PVA in meeting sustainable packaging goals.

Expansion in Textile Industry: Polyvinyl alcohol is increasingly used in textile sizing to improve fiber adhesion. The textile industry grew significantly in 2023, with China, India, and the EU producing around 54 million metric tons of textiles collectively, up from 51 million tons in 2022 (World Bank data). This growth, coupled with higher fabric quality standards, boosts PVA demand. As reported by the IMF, the manufacturing sector in developing economies, primarily India and China, observed a 6% increase in textile output in 2023. This expansion drives a consistent demand for PVA as an integral part of textile processing.

Advancements in Construction Materials: The global construction sectors output reached $10 trillion in 2023, according to the World Bank. PVAs application in cement and adhesive formulations to enhance strength and flexibility is well-suited for infrastructure projects, particularly in Asia, where construction investments surged by 8% in 2023. Infrastructure investments in India, for example, crossed $1.5 trillion in 2023, fueling demand for innovative materials like PVA in construction applications. With urbanization driving new projects, PVA is increasingly in demand for high-performance construction applications worldwide.

Market Challenges

Fluctuating Raw Material Prices: In 2023, the average cost of raw materials for PVA production fluctuated due to supply chain disruptions and crude oil price variations, with crude oil prices hovering around $80 per barrel, as reported by the World Bank. Since vinyl acetate monomer (VAM), a critical component of PVA, is derived from crude oil, these fluctuations have affected production costs, creating financial instability for manufacturers. The dependency on oil prices poses a significant challenge for consistent PVA production.

Availability of Substitutes: PVA faces competition from alternative polymers such as polyvinyl butyral (PVB) and polyethylene glycol (PEG) in several applications. For example, in 2023, PEG demand in the healthcare industry rose by 7% due to its high adaptability in pharmaceutical formulations. The World Bank also noted a 5% growth in PVBs use in construction, affecting PVAs market share in sectors where cost-effective substitutes are viable. The availability of these alternatives poses a challenge to PVAs dominance.

Global Polyvinyl Alcohol (PVA) Market Future Outlook

Over the next five years, the global PVA market is expected to experience significant growth, driven by the increasing adoption of biodegradable materials in packaging and the expansion of the textile industry. Technological advancements in PVA production and the development of new applications in electronics and pharmaceuticals are anticipated to further propel market growth.

Market Opportunities

Technological Innovations: The World Bank reported a 15% increase in government grants for polymer research in 2023, benefiting PVA production technology. Innovations, such as enhanced biodegradability and improved performance in extreme conditions, are expected to expand PVAs applications. The integration of nanotechnology and 3D printing in materials science has created new avenues for PVA in specialized applications, such as biomedical devices, where demand increased by 10% in 2023. The advancement in technology presents a strong growth opportunity for the market.

Emerging Markets: Emerging economies such as Brazil, India, and South Africa reported a collective 7% GDP growth in 2023, with infrastructure development as a key contributor (IMF data). Investments in these regions exceeded $1 trillion, creating substantial demand for construction materials and packaging solutions where PVA finds increasing application. As these economies continue to invest in sustainable and infrastructural projects, they present a lucrative market opportunity for PVA.
